Understanding Danger Tape

Danger tape is a type of tape used to demarcate hazardous areas. Typically colored in bright yellow or red, this tape warns individuals to stay away from dangerous zones. The Applications of Danger Tape

The applications of danger tape are vast and varied. In construction, it denotes areas where heavy machinery works or where there may be falling debris. In hospitals or emergency services, it can be used to restrict access to contaminated or hazardous materials. Moreover, danger tape is not limited to outdoor environments. Warehouses and factories frequently employ this tape to indicate floors that are slippery or areas where dangerous equipment is in operation. Additionally, utilities companies might use caution danger tape to signal underground pipelines or electric lines, thereby ensuring the safety of workers during maintenance and operational tasks.

Yellow Danger Tape: The Universal Warning

Yellow danger tape holds a unique significance in safety. It is universally recognized as a warning color, often symbolizing caution. This color is particularly useful in environments where an immediate warning is essential but where complete restriction of access is not necessary. Yellow tape can mark the edge of a construction site or point to potential hazards, ensuring that individuals remain alert as they navigate through areas that require extra care.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

  1. What types of materials are used to make danger tape?
    Danger tape is typically made from materials such as polyethylene or vinyl. These materials offer durability and weather resistance. High-quality tapes may also feature strong adhesive properties to ensure they remain in place, even in challenging conditions.
  2. Can danger tape be used indoors?
    Yes, danger tape is versatile and can be used in both indoor and outdoor environments. It is often employed in warehouses, factories, and other indoor settings to demarcate areas with potential hazards, ensuring that individuals exercise caution.
